Would you like to be notified when this item becomes available?

Enter your email address below and we'll let you know.

Thank you, we’ll be in touch soon!

Select size

Choose Size

Reviews

Fit:

Runs Small

True to size

Runs Large

Length:

Runs Short

True to size

Runs Long

Filters & Sort

Sale Dresses Under £40

(1156)

48% off

Petite White Sylvia Midi Dress
Petite White Sylvia Midi Dress

Petite White Sylvia Midi Dress

1,273.00 MDL 2,448.00 MDL

77% off

Orange & Cream Nikita Check Midi Dress
Orange & Cream Nikita Check Midi Dress

Nikita Check Midi Dress

490.00 MDL 2,122.00 MDL

73% off

Pink Geo Delilah Mini Dress
Pink Geo Delilah Mini Dress

Pink Geo Delilah Mini Dress

490.00 MDL 1,796.00 MDL

61% off

Olive Green Balloon Sleeve Ria Midi Dress
Olive Green Balloon Sleeve Ria Midi Dress

Olive Green Balloon Sleeve Ria Midi Dress

882.00 MDL 2,253.00 MDL

64% off

Green Ditsy Floral Lara Midaxi Dress
Green Ditsy Floral Lara Midaxi Dress

Lara Midi Dress

653.00 MDL 1,796.00 MDL

36% off

Harriet Floral Petite Felicia Midi Dress
Harriet Floral Petite Felicia Midi Dress

Harriet Floral Petite Felicia Midi Dress

1,143.00 MDL 1,796.00 MDL

61% off

Pink Ditsy Floral Eva Flutter Sleeve Midi Dress
Pink Ditsy Floral Eva Flutter Sleeve Midi Dress

Eva Midi Dress

621.00 MDL 1,600.00 MDL

71% off

Orange Button Through Ribbed Midi Dress
Orange Button Through Ribbed Midi Dress

Button Through Ribbed Midi Dress

621.00 MDL 2,122.00 MDL

62% off

Burgundy Satin Jacquard Sydney Maxi Dress
Burgundy Satin Jacquard Sydney Maxi Dress

Burgundy Satin Jacquard Sydney Maxi Dress

980.00 MDL 2,579.00 MDL

71% off

Abbey Strawberry Black Tessie Mini Dress
Abbey Strawberry Black Tessie Mini Dress

Tessie Mini Shirt Dress

392.00 MDL 1,371.00 MDL

73% off

Petite Sunflower Floral Esme Midi Dress
Petite Sunflower Floral Esme Midi Dress

Petite Sunflower Floral Esme Midi Dress

490.00 MDL 1,796.00 MDL

80% off

Multi Big Floral Lolita Midi Dress
Multi Big Floral Lolita Midi Dress

Lolita Midi Dress

621.00 MDL 3,101.00 MDL

62% off

Leopard Print Ruffle Trimmed Ivy Midi Dress
Leopard Print Ruffle Trimmed Ivy Midi Dress

Leopard Print Ruffle Trimmed Ivy Midi Dress

816.00 MDL 2,122.00 MDL

49% off

Green Colorado Mini Dress
Green Colorado Mini Dress

Green Colorado Mini Dress

980.00 MDL 1,926.00 MDL

2 Colours

Product color swatch option #1
Product color swatch option #2

75% off

Purple Floral Ariana Midi Dress
Purple Floral Ariana Midi Dress

Ariana Midi Dress

490.00 MDL 1,926.00 MDL

61% off

Green Big Floral Ellis Midi Dress
Green Big Floral Ellis Midi Dress

Ellis Midi Dress

621.00 MDL 1,600.00 MDL

60% off

Khaki Green Gingham Check Rachel Midi Dress
Khaki Green Gingham Check Rachel Midi Dress

Khaki Green Gingham Check Rachel Midi Dress

719.00 MDL 1,796.00 MDL

74% off

NC Boutique Yellow Broderie Anglaise Paris Mini Dress
NC Boutique Yellow Broderie Anglaise Paris Mini Dress

Yellow Broderie Anglaise Paris Mini Dress

816.00 MDL 3,101.00 MDL

74% off

Petite Black Coco Midaxi Dress
Petite Black Coco Midaxi Dress

Petite Black Coco Midaxi Dress

816.00 MDL 3,101.00 MDL

61% off

Orange Big Floral Eva Midi Dress
Orange Big Floral Eva Midi Dress

Eva Midi Dress

621.00 MDL 1,600.00 MDL

60% off

Brown Floral Serena Mini Dress
Brown Floral Serena Mini Dress

Brown Floral Serena Mini Dress

588.00 MDL 1,469.00 MDL

49% off

Green Floral Alexa Mini Dress
Green Floral Alexa Mini Dress

Green Floral Alexa Mini Dress

816.00 MDL 1,600.00 MDL

1 Colours

Product color swatch option #1

73% off

Black Floral Hadley Midi Dress
Black Floral Hadley Midi Dress

Hadley Dress

490.00 MDL 1,796.00 MDL

61% off

Maternity Selena Midi Dress
Maternity Selena Midi Dress

Maternity Selena Midi Dress

621.00 MDL 1,600.00 MDL

61% off

Black with White Stitching Marie Prairie Midi Dress
Black with White Stitching Marie Prairie Midi Dress

Black with White Stitching Marie Prairie Midi Dress

1,012.00 MDL 2,579.00 MDL

77% off

Blue Sierra Mini Dress
Blue Sierra Mini Dress

Sierra Mini Dress

490.00 MDL 2,122.00 MDL

59% off

Multi Big Floral Helena Midi Dress
Multi Big Floral Helena Midi Dress

Helena Midi Dress

653.00 MDL 1,600.00 MDL

41% off

Green Floral Alexa Midi Dress
Green Floral Alexa Midi Dress

Green Floral Alexa Midi Dress

1,143.00 MDL 1,926.00 MDL

1 Colours

Product color swatch option #1

61% off

Brown Gingham Rachel Midi Dress
Brown Gingham Rachel Midi Dress

Brown Gingham Rachel Midi Dress

621.00 MDL 1,600.00 MDL

73% off

Pink and Orange Big Floral Penny Mini Dress
Pink and Orange Big Floral Penny Mini Dress

Pink and Orange Big Floral Penny Mini Dress

392.00 MDL 1,469.00 MDL

60% off

Speckle Print Sandra Midi Dress
Speckle Print Sandra Midi Dress

Speckle Print Sandra Midi Dress

588.00 MDL 1,469.00 MDL

61% off

Heather Mini Rose Maternity Luna Midi Dress
Heather Mini Rose Maternity Luna Midi Dress

Maternity Luna Midi Dress

621.00 MDL 1,600.00 MDL

61% off

Red Rochelle Smock Midi Dress
Red Rochelle Smock Midi Dress

Red Rochelle Smock Midi Dress

751.00 MDL 1,926.00 MDL

68% off

Lilac Heart Print Petite Annalise Midi Dress
Lilac Heart Print Petite Annalise Midi Dress

Petite Lilac Heart Print Annalise Midi Dress

621.00 MDL 1,926.00 MDL

55% off

Petite Green Floral Midi Shift Dress
Petite Green Floral Midi Shift Dress

Petite Green Floral Esme Midi Dress

816.00 MDL 1,796.00 MDL

40% off

Petite Animal Spot Print Luna Midi Dress
Petite Animal Spot Print Luna Midi Dress

Petite Animal Spot Print Luna Midi Dress

1,078.00 MDL 1,796.00 MDL

65% off

Neon Green Millie Smock Midaxi Dress
Neon Green Millie Smock Midaxi Dress

Neon Green Millie Smock Midaxi Dress

621.00 MDL 1,796.00 MDL

72% off

Sage Green Harriet Midi Dress
Sage Green Harriet Midi Dress

Harriet Midi Dress

816.00 MDL 2,905.00 MDL

60% off

Petite Blue and Orange Check Rachel Midi Dress
Petite Blue and Orange Check Rachel Midi Dress

Petite Blue & Orange Check Rachel Midi Dress

719.00 MDL 1,796.00 MDL

48% off

Green/Pink Stripe Elora Petite Midi Dress
Green/Pink Stripe Elora Petite Midi Dress

Petite Green Stripe Elora Midi Dress

1,273.00 MDL 2,448.00 MDL

78% off

Green Floral Floaty Kait Midi Dress
Green Floral Floaty Kait Midi Dress

Green Floral Floaty Kait Midi Dress

490.00 MDL 2,253.00 MDL

64% off

Blue Reed Crinkle Collar Midaxi Dress

Blue Reed Crinkle Collar Midaxi Dress

653.00 MDL 1,796.00 MDL

61% off

Blue & Navy Check Annalise Check Midi Dress
Blue & Navy Check Annalise Check Midi Dress

Annalise Check Midi Dress

751.00 MDL 1,926.00 MDL

61% off

Big Floral Petite Alexa with Shirring Dress
Big Floral Petite Alexa with Shirring Dress

Big Floral Petite Alexa with Shirring Midi Dress

621.00 MDL 1,600.00 MDL

55% off

Beige Gingham Check Lily Midi Dress
Beige Gingham Check Lily Midi Dress

Beige Gingham Check Lily Midi Dress

816.00 MDL 1,796.00 MDL

1 Colours

Product color swatch option #1

77% off

Green Halter Neck Mock-Crochet Midi Dress
Green Halter Neck Mock-Crochet Midi Dress

Green Halter Neck Mock-Crochet Midi Dress

490.00 MDL 2,122.00 MDL

65% off

Maternity Blue Floral Delilah Midi Dress
Maternity Blue Floral Delilah Midi Dress

Maternity Blue Floral Delilah Midi Dress

621.00 MDL 1,796.00 MDL

77% off

White Spot Jolene Mini Dress
White Spot Jolene Mini Dress

Jolene Mini Wrap Dress

490.00 MDL 2,122.00 MDL